Operating Systems: Design and Implementation (2nd Edition)

Operating Systems: Design and Implementation (2nd Edition) by Andrew S. Tanenbaum, Albert S. Woodhull
English | 1997 | ISBN: 0136386776 | 939 Pages | DJVU | 15.8 MB

Most books on operating systems deal with theory while ignoring practice. While the usual principles are covered in detail, the book describes a small, but real UNIX-like operating system: MINIX. The book demonstrates how it works while illustrating the principles behind it.
